However, it is the Road of Devastation DLC that transforms this from a great shooter into a must-own title. This expansion abandons the linear narrative structure in favor of a rogue-lite loop. Players wake up in a laboratory and must choose a path through three distinct zones. Upon death, they restart but retain certain upgrades and knowledge. Before diving into the extras, let's honor the core loop. Dead Nation isn't about survival horror; it's about surviving a horror onslaught . You play as either Jack McReady or Scarlett Blake, navigating top-down city streets, malls, and sewers flooded with the infected.
